Is Iran warmer or hotter than Folsom, California?

On average across the year, yes, Iran is hotter than Folsom, California . Iran has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Folsom, California has an average temperature of 16°C/61°F.

Iran's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 37°C/99°F, which is hotter than Folsom, California's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F).

Is Iran colder or cooler than Folsom, California?

On average across the year, no, Iran is not colder than Folsom, California . Iran has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F and Folsom, California has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.



Iran's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-1°C/30°F, which is colder than Folsom, California's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F).
